package org.apache.lucene.search;
import java.io.IOException;
import org.apache.lucene.document.Document;
import org.apache.lucene.document.Field;
import org.apache.lucene.index.IndexReader;
import org.apache.lucene.index.RandomIndexWriter;
import org.apache.lucene.index.Term;
import org.apache.lucene.store.Directory;
import org.apache.lucene.util.LuceneTestCase;
public class TestLargeNumHitsTopDocsCollector extends LuceneTestCase {
private Directory dir;
private IndexReader reader;
private final Query testQuery = new BooleanQuery.Builder()
.add(new TermQuery(new Term("field", "5")), BooleanClause.Occur.SHOULD)
.add(new MatchAllDocsQuery(), BooleanClause.Occur.SHOULD)
.build();
@Override
public void setUp() throws Exception {
super.setUp();
dir = newDirectory();
RandomIndexWriter writer = new RandomIndexWriter(random(), dir);
for (int i = 0; i < 1_000; i++) {
Document doc = new Document();
doc.add(newStringField("field", "5", Field.Store.NO));
writer.addDocument(doc);
writer.addDocument(new Document());
}
reader = writer.getReader();
writer.close();
}
@Override
public void tearDown() throws Exception {
reader.close();
dir.close();
dir = null;
super.tearDown();
}
public void testRequestMoreHitsThanCollected() throws Exception {
runNumHits(150);
}
public void testSingleNumHit() throws Exception {
runNumHits(1);
}
public void testRequestLessHitsThanCollected() throws Exception {
runNumHits(25);
}
public void testIllegalArguments() throws IOException {
IndexSearcher searcher = newSearcher(reader);
LargeNumHitsTopDocsCollector largeCollector = new LargeNumHitsTopDocsCollector(15);
TopScoreDocCollector regularCollector = TopScoreDocCollector.create(15, null, Integer.MAX_VALUE);
searcher.search(testQuery, largeCollector);
searcher.search(testQuery, regularCollector);
assertEquals(largeCollector.totalHits, regularCollector.totalHits);
IllegalArgumentException expected = expectThrows(IllegalArgumentException.class, () -> {
largeCollector.topDocs(350_000);
});
assertTrue(expected.getMessage().contains("Incorrect number of hits requested"));
}
public void testNoPQBuild() throws IOException {
IndexSearcher searcher = newSearcher(reader);
LargeNumHitsTopDocsCollector largeCollector = new LargeNumHitsTopDocsCollector(250_000);
TopScoreDocCollector regularCollector = TopScoreDocCollector.create(250_000, null, Integer.MAX_VALUE);
searcher.search(testQuery, largeCollector);
searcher.search(testQuery, regularCollector);
assertEquals(largeCollector.totalHits, regularCollector.totalHits);
assertEquals(largeCollector.pq, null);
assertEquals(largeCollector.pqTop, null);
}
public void testPQBuild() throws IOException {
IndexSearcher searcher = newSearcher(reader);
LargeNumHitsTopDocsCollector largeCollector = new LargeNumHitsTopDocsCollector(50);
TopScoreDocCollector regularCollector = TopScoreDocCollector.create(50, null, Integer.MAX_VALUE);
searcher.search(testQuery, largeCollector);
searcher.search(testQuery, regularCollector);
assertEquals(largeCollector.totalHits, regularCollector.totalHits);
assertNotEquals(largeCollector.pq, null);
assertNotEquals(largeCollector.pqTop, null);
}
public void testNoPQHitsOrder() throws IOException {
IndexSearcher searcher = newSearcher(reader);
LargeNumHitsTopDocsCollector largeCollector = new LargeNumHitsTopDocsCollector(250_000);
TopScoreDocCollector regularCollector = TopScoreDocCollector.create(250_000, null, Integer.MAX_VALUE);
searcher.search(testQuery, largeCollector);
searcher.search(testQuery, regularCollector);
assertEquals(largeCollector.totalHits, regularCollector.totalHits);
assertEquals(largeCollector.pq, null);
assertEquals(largeCollector.pqTop, null);
TopDocs topDocs = largeCollector.topDocs();
if (topDocs.scoreDocs.length > 0) {
float preScore = topDocs.scoreDocs[0].score;
for (ScoreDoc scoreDoc : topDocs.scoreDocs) {
assert scoreDoc.score <= preScore;
preScore = scoreDoc.score;
}
}
}
private void runNumHits(int numHits) throws IOException {
IndexSearcher searcher = newSearcher(reader);
LargeNumHitsTopDocsCollector largeCollector = new LargeNumHitsTopDocsCollector(numHits);
TopScoreDocCollector regularCollector = TopScoreDocCollector.create(numHits, null, Integer.MAX_VALUE);
searcher.search(testQuery, largeCollector);
searcher.search(testQuery, regularCollector);
assertEquals(largeCollector.totalHits, regularCollector.totalHits);
TopDocs firstTopDocs = largeCollector.topDocs();
TopDocs secondTopDocs = regularCollector.topDocs();
assertEquals(firstTopDocs.scoreDocs.length, secondTopDocs.scoreDocs.length);
CheckHits.checkEqual(testQuery, firstTopDocs.scoreDocs, secondTopDocs.scoreDocs);
}
}
